Eine effiziente SQL-Entwicklung erfordert häufig die Verwendung von Variablen in Abfragen. Oracle SQL Developer bietet unkomplizierte Methoden, um dies zu erreichen.
Ähnlich wie andere Datenbanksysteme verwendet Oracle SQL Developer die DEFINE
-Anweisung zum Deklarieren und Zuweisen von Werten zu Variablen. Die Syntax ist einfach:
<code class="language-sql">DEFINE variable_name = 'variable_value';</code>
Um beispielsweise eine Variable emp_id
mit dem Wert 1234 zu erstellen, verwenden Sie:
<code class="language-sql">DEFINE emp_id = 1234;</code>
Sobald Variablen definiert sind, können sie mithilfe eines doppelten kaufmännischen Und-Zeichens (&&
) problemlos in SQL-Abfragen integriert werden. So rufen Sie Mitarbeiterdaten basierend auf der Variablen emp_id
aus der Tabelle Employees
ab:
<code class="language-sql">SELECT * FROM Employees WHERE EmployeeID = &&emp_id;</code>
$$
)Oracle SQL Developer bietet auch eine Alternative mit doppelten Dollarzeichen ($$
) für die Variablenersetzung in Abfragen. Die entsprechende Abfrage mit dieser Methode lautet:
<code class="language-sql">SELECT * FROM Employees WHERE EmployeeID = $$emp_id;</code>
Im Wesentlichen umfasst die Variablenmanipulation in Oracle SQL Developer die Definition von Variablen mit DEFINE
und deren Referenzierung in Abfragen über &&
oder $$
. Diese dynamische Wertzuweisung verbessert die Möglichkeiten zur Datenbearbeitung.
Das obige ist der detaillierte Inhalt vonWie kann ich Variablen in Oracle SQL Developer-Abfragen verwenden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!